Bahrain GP schedule: testing, qualifying and race times
The 2023 Formula 1 Championship begins with the inaugural Bahrain Grand Prix. Check out the schedule for FP1, FP2 and FP3, qualifying and Sunday’s race.
The time has come. The curtain rises on the 2023 Formula 1 Championship this weekend with the first Grand Prix of the year in Bahrain. The winter tests took place at the Sakhir circuit a week earlier so that the teams could gather initial data for their new cars.
The three-day competition starts on Friday afternoon with the first free practice and ends on Sunday afternoon with the race. Check out the detailed program of the first Grand Prix of the season.
Bahrain GP 2023 schedule
Friday March 3rd
- 1.30 – 2.30 p.m.: 1st free practice (FP1)
- 17.00 – 18.00: 2nd free practice (FP2)
Saturday March 4th
- 1.30 – 2.30 p.m.: 3rd free practice (FP2)
- 5:00 p.m. – 6:00 p.m.: Qualifying tests (qualifying)
Sunday March 5th
- 5 p.m.: Race
